Waterlooville is a thriving and well-connected town in South Hampshire, perfectly positioned between Portsmouth and the South Downs. The area offers a diverse mix of homes, from charming post-war semi-detached houses to modern family estates and new-build developments, making it ideal for first-time buyers, growing families, and downsizers alike. The town benefits from excellent road links via the A3, convenient public transport, and access to nearby rail services, making commuting straightforward. Residents enjoy a wide range of amenities, including shopping centres, local schools, leisure facilities, and green spaces, while the surrounding countryside provides a peaceful escape. With steady demand and a resilient property market, Waterlooville continues to be a sought-after location for buyers looking for both practicality and lifestyle.
